1/10
Wake up, the movie's over
aldiboronti9 November 2019
My compliments to anyone who managed to stay awake for the whole film. My sympathies too. The movie is so badly acted, so cheaply made and so boring that most people will be gently snoring 20 minutes in. At least that way they can avoid having to endure this mess. An example of its low budget: when the doctor is in the hospital we see a sign on the wall, Ward C. You can tell it's made of paper or card and has simply been stuck on the wall. OK, i know it must be hard making movies on a minuscule budget but seriously,, guys? As for the acting .... wooden? We're talking IKEA here. The summation is by all means watch it but don't expect to stay awake.

8/10
Neat indie horror movie
Woodyanders2 December 2021
Warning: Spoilers
Psychiatrist Philip Tanner (a solid performance by Scott Broughton) decides to read the diary of teenage gal Molly Goldman (an unnerving portrayal by Kelly Francis Fischer) to figure out why she murdered her family. Phillip winds up falling into a state of insomnia and confusion that led Molly to go crazy.

Writer/director relates the engrossing story at a steady pace, adroitly crafts a creepy and unsettling atmosphere, takes time to develop the characters, grounds the premise in a believable workaday reality, and generates a good deal of tension. The sound acting from the capable cast keeps this movie humming: Traci L. Newman as Philip's concerned wife Charlotte, Jeffrey Wells as pragmatic colleague Jeffrey Black, and Lauretta Compton as Philip's sweet daughter Cindy. The surprise grim ending packs a jolting punch. A cool little flick.

7/10
A weird, occasionally taboo horror thriller...
Mack Lambert28 March 2019
Warning: Spoilers
A psychiatrist is studying the diary of a girl who murdered her family, and would later end up committing suicide. The longer he reads the journal for his report, the more paranoid and insane he becomes. It reaches a climax where doctor's state of mind will affect more people than he realizes.

I saw this as my local mom and pop theater in Buffalo, and I enjoyed it. I appreciated the hints of Lovecraftian elements (a person going insane while reading something they weren't supposed to). The opening sequence was suspenseful, and well edited. The only put off was a blatant display of incest, which struck me as shock for the sake of shock. Also, the sound editing was off with the music overpowering the dialogue at points.

Other than that, this is a good movie, plain and simple. Support indie horror, and give this film a look.

4/10
Disconnected horror fable
sgmi-535797 October 2022
The idea and the execution aren't bad, but we're always aware this is shoestring production, and end up marveling at the way it's made on the cheap, rather than actually falling into the story. After a psychiatrist suddenly dies while researching a patients journal, the job passes to Dr Philip Tanner, who soon figures out the secrets of the diary. More of a thriller than any type of actual horror picture, we're presented with an interesting concept, and serviceable acting. A decent production, but we're always aware of limits of the filmmakers. Horror completists and genre obsessives will have to see, for some of the interesting ideas in the film. Most others should question how much time they'd like to invest. 4/10.

6/10
She strangled herself
nogodnomasters13 October 2019
Warning: Spoilers
Fifteen-year-old Molly Marie Goldman (Kelly Frances Fischer) keeps a diary and has cursed anyone who reads it. Not exactly sure how that works. She has bad vivid nightmares. When her brother comes home from the service, she kills all of her family and their dog too. Her doctor read her diary and the film picks up at his funeral as the diary is handed over to Philip (Scott Broughton) who suddenly has issues.

I liked the characters especially the smart-alec Charlotte Tanner (Traci L. Newman) who came across in a realistic manner. The story was a cut above but lacked a reason for the curse, to begin with, i.e. why did Molly have bad dreams?

Guide: F-word. Brief sex. No nudity.
